Ralph (Trey) Blakeney Dazzles in Hough Win
Ralph (Trey) Blakeney was instrumental in extending Hough's winning streak to six on Thursday. Blakeney did his part (and then some), throwing for 178 yards and four touchdowns, while also rushing for 47 yards for the 'W'. Those 47 rushing yards gave him a new career-high.
On the season, Blakeney has thrown 22 touchdowns (and and only 3 picks) while averaging 221.3 passing yards per game. That doesn't tell the whole story though: at this point last year, he was only averaging 11.14 rushing yards per game. This year he is averaging 26.71 rushing yards.

Zierre Brooks Turns in Season-Best Effort
Chambers was led to victory by Zierre Brooks, who turned in his biggest game of the season on Thursday. Brooks rushed for 201 yards while picking up 11.2 yards per carry, good enough to set a new career-high in rushing yards in the process. He was no stranger to the big play, taking off on a dash that went for 67 yards.
This year, Brooks has averaged 96.4 rushing yards per game. He's made a big improvement compared to last season: at this point last year, he was only averaging 4.71 rushing yards per game.

Littlejohn Made His Presence Known in West Mecklenburg's 19-14 Loss
Elijah Littlejohn continued his hot streak on Thursday by dropping his sixth-straight game with at least two sacks. He picked up two sacks and made ten total tackles (3.0 for loss).
West Mecklenburg is on a five-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 1-6. Littlejohn will try to repeat (or improve) on that dominant performance when he faces off against Hopewell on Friday.
